DIRECTORS WHO EXPLORE THIS
Sergei Eisenstein → Soviet Union

His revolutionary montage technique celebrated labor and industrial progress in films like 'October' and 'The Battleship Potemkin,' making construction and workers central to cinematic poetry.

Ken Loach → United Kingdom

His social realist films like 'Kes' and 'I, Daniel Blake' intimately portray the struggles of working-class people and the dignity of manual labor with unflinching authenticity.

Jia Zhangke → China

His films document China's rapid urbanization and construction boom, exploring how labor and industrial transformation reshape human lives and communities in works like 'Still Life' and 'A Touch of Sin.'
